So now that I've had a day to use this I have a question, or maybe it is an observation...

The draw seems different when I put the endcap back on when using it without the cable. And opposite of what I'd expect. It draws nicely with the cap off, but airy with it on. I have to draw harder to fire up the carto with the cap off than I do with the cap on. Anyone else experience that? Or is there an explanation?

Yes, the cap cuts down on the air pulling through the battery. If you loosen the cap, it improves. For me, it's been pretty much a non-factor.
